National Geographic Hires Griffin

NEW YORK–Magazine veteran John Griffin will replace Robert Sims when he retires at the end of the year as president of magazine publishing for the National Geographic Society, the Washington, D.C., based organization said Thursday.

He will oversee the business side of the flagship National Geographic magazine, and editorial and business operations of spin-off titles National Geographic Traveler, National Geographic Adventure and National Geographic World.

Griffin, executive vice president and chief operating officer of Hearst Magazines International since last October and president of Rodale from 1990 to 2000, is set to start at National Geographic in September.
